Exactly How Roof Air Flow Functions
Reliable roofing air flow relies on the natural activity of air to create a balance in between intake and exhaust. When you install vents, you're basically enabling fresh air to enter your attic room while making it possible for warm, stale air to escape. This process assists control temperature level and dampness levels, avoiding concerns like mold growth and roof damages.
Intake vents, usually found at the eaves, reel in cool air from outdoors. Meanwhile, exhaust vents, located near the ridge of the roof covering, let hot air increase and departure. The difference in temperature level develops an all-natural airflow, referred to as the stack result. As cozy air surges, it produces a vacuum that pulls in cooler air from the reduced vents.

Trick Installment Factors To Consider
When setting up roofing ventilation, several crucial factors to consider can make or break your system's performance. First, you require to analyze your roofing system's design. The pitch, form, and materials all influence air flow and air flow option. Ensure to pick vents that suit your roofing system kind and neighborhood environment conditions.

Ideally, you'll desire a balanced system with consumption and exhaust vents placed for ideal airflow. Area intake vents low on the roofing and exhaust vents near the optimal to urge an all-natural flow of air. This configuration assists stop wetness build-up and promotes energy performance.
Do not ignore insulation. Proper insulation in your attic prevents warmth from leaving and keeps your home comfortable. Ensure that insulation doesn't obstruct your vents, as this can hinder airflow.
Finally, consider upkeep. Select air flow systems that are simple to access for cleaning and assessment. Regular maintenance ensures your system continues to operate successfully in time.
